9 Cheverton Avenue is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Withernsea (HU19 2HW). It has a recorded floor area of 117 m² (around 1259 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2022)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in April 2018 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and lighting went from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 80). Main heating runs on electricity.

Today's modelled estimate of £125,000 sits 108.3% above the 2018 sale of £60,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£48/sq ft) was about 33% below the postcode norm. 2 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used. Sold July 2018 for £60,000.
